Windev Webdev

Discussions about GdPicture.NET usage in non managed applications built in vb6, Delphi, vfp, MFC c++ etc...
Post Reply
tAkAmAkA
Posts: 74
Joined: Mon Oct 27, 2008 6:38 pm

Windev Webdev

Post by tAkAmAkA » Fri Dec 28, 2012 3:54 am

Bonjour,

Peut-on utiliser GdPicture avec Windev ou Webdev de PCsoft?

Merci de votre attention

User avatar
Loïc
Site Admin
Posts: 5881
Joined: Tue Oct 17, 2006 10:48 pm
Location: France
Contact:

Re: Windev Webdev

Post by Loïc » Wed Jan 02, 2013 4:57 pm

Bonjour,

Oui. Nous avons quelques clients utilisant GdPicture.NET COM edition sous windev. Par contre nous n'avons pas d'exemple d'utilisation car nous n'avons pas de compétence Windev en interne.

Cordialement,

Loïc Carrère

Greg
Posts: 17
Joined: Thu Oct 11, 2012 8:31 am

Re: Windev Webdev

Post by Greg » Fri Jan 18, 2013 4:03 pm

Oui moi !

Société de développement de logiciel pour les collectivités locales.

je suis en train d'implémenter un module d'acte scanné dans notre logiciel d'état civil.

Si tu as des questions, n'hésite pas !

tAkAmAkA
Posts: 74
Joined: Mon Oct 27, 2008 6:38 pm

Re: Windev Webdev

Post by tAkAmAkA » Tue Apr 30, 2013 10:21 pm

Bonjour à tous, à Loïc et à Greg,

Je fais mes premiers essais dans WindevExpress avant de casser ma tirelire.

J'arrive à poser un GdViewer en déclarant l'activeX.

Par contre je ne parviens pas à déclarer un object GdPictureImaging.
Le fichier n'est pas présent dans la liste lors de la déclaration du champ ActiveX, alors je tente par le code en essayant de copier ce que j'ai lu ici ou là:

A l'init de mon champ AX_Imaging:

Code: Select all

AX_Imaging est un objet Automation dynamique 
AX_Imaging = allouer un objet Automation "GdPicture.GdPictureImaging"
AX_Imaging>>SetLicenseNumber("xxx")
nImageIdEXPRESS est un entier = AX_Imaging>>CreateGdPictureImageFromFile(COMBO_DerniersDocs[COMBO_DerniersDocs])
Trace ("nImageIdEXPRESS  " +nImageIdEXPRESS)
Mais j'ai l'erreur:
Erreur à la ligne 3 du traitement Initialisation de AX_Imaging.
L'objet automation 'GdPicture.GdPictureImaging' n'est pas installé sur votre système.

----- Informations techniques -----

Projet : WD Visualiseur PDF

Appel WL :
Traitement de 'Initialisation de AX_Imaging' (FEN_ApercuPDF.AX_Imaging), ligne 3, thread 0

Que s'est-il passé ?
L'objet automation 'GdPicture.GdPictureImaging' n'est pas installé sur votre système.

Code erreur : 2202
Niveau : erreur fatale (EL_FATAL)

Dump de l'erreur du module 'wd170vm.dll' (17.0.288.4 EXPRESS).
Identifiant des informations détaillées (.err) : 2202
Informations de débogage :
Instruction AutomCreate
Informations supplémentaires :
EIT_PILEWL :
Initialisation de AX_Imaging (FEN_ApercuPDF.AX_Imaging), ligne 3
EIT_DATEHEURE : 30/04/2013 16:14:22
Pourtant je déclare sans problème la référence dans VBA, c'est donc que le fichier existe?

Merci de votre aide.

User avatar
Loïc
Site Admin
Posts: 5881
Joined: Tue Oct 17, 2006 10:48 pm
Location: France
Contact:

Re: Windev Webdev

Post by Loïc » Wed May 01, 2013 8:12 pm

Salut !

Si tu remplaces: GdPicture.GdPictureImaging par GdPicture9.GdPictureImaging ça donne quoi ?

tAkAmAkA
Posts: 74
Joined: Mon Oct 27, 2008 6:38 pm

Re: Windev Webdev

Post by tAkAmAkA » Thu May 02, 2013 4:04 am

Ca donne que c'est bon même!

J'ai viré le champ ActivX et j'ai déclaré dans l'init de la fenêtre

Code: Select all

//AX_Imaging = new gdPictureImaging
AX_Imaging est un objet Automation dynamique 
AX_Imaging = allouer un objet Automation "GdPicture9.GdPictureImaging"
AX_Imaging>>SetLicenseNumber("xxx")
Merci Loïc

Post Reply

Who is online

Users browsing this forum: No registered users and 1 guest